The new lifestyle that has been established due to economic growth and globalizations has witnessed an upsurge in lifestyle disorders such as obesity, diabetes, cardiovascular disorders, and cancer. The indulgence in fast food and other junk foods together with a sedentary life have been causative factors of these diseases. Nutraceuticals, coined as a merger of “nutrition” and “pharmaceuticals,” may provide a breakthrough solution to reverse the situation. These foods, some of which involve herbal extracts, dietary supplements, and functional foods, provide added health benefits to the mere function of sustenance. By their provision of vitamins, minerals, antioxidants, and bioactive components, nutraceuticals contribute to preventing certain chronic diseases, enhancing general wellness, and augmenting the structural and functional body processes. Examples of classifications that nutraceuticals belong to are foods with functions, dietary supplements, medicinal foods, herbal products, prebiotics and probiotics, and specialty products. Antioxidant-rich nutraceuticals are important for diminishing inflammation, modifying gene expression, and quenching free-radicals. They support multiple health outcomes including prevention of chronic disease, improved skin, immune function, and improved aging. Looking to the future nutraceuticals will focus on personalized nutrition, sustainable and plant-based ingredients, functional foods, immune support, gut health and the microbiome, adaptogens for stress management, more innovative delivery methods, keeping up with the regulatory environment, understanding implications for digital health, and wellness. As the number of consumers looking to improve their health and well-being increase, it is important that products in the nutraceuticals space are not just safe and effective, but also of the highest quality.

Nutraceuticals have their roots in the early 1900s, when Dr. Stephen DeFelice first used the term “nutraceutical” in 1989. Combining the terms “nutrition” with “pharmaceutical,” it describes food or food-based products that offer health advantages beyond simple sustenance, such as illness prevention and treatment. Nutraceuticals’ origins, however, go all the way back to ancient civilizations. Long before the current name was coined, cultures like the Greeks, Chinese, and Egyptians were aware of the therapeutic qualities of a variety of foods and herbs. For instance, throughout history, it has been normal practice to treat illnesses and enhance health by using natural ingredients, functional meals, and herbal treatments. The development of nutraceuticals as evolved to encompass particular goods like vitamins, minerals, probiotics, and dietary supplements in the modern era as scientific knowledge of nutrition and biochemistry has grown. By using bioactive chemicals, which can have physiological effects beyond their nutritional value, these products seek to promote health and avoid chronic diseases.

Antioxidants are compounds that slow down or stop oxidation-induced degradation, damage, or destruction. Tissue deficiencies and/or low dietary levels of substances known as antioxidants are linked to the prevalent diseases and conditions of the twenty-first century, including cardiovascular disease, diabetes, cataracts, high blood pressure, infertility, respiratory infections, and rheumatoid arthritis. Free radicals are produced during oxidation. At the molecular level, these free radicals destroy everything they come into contact with. Antioxidants are powerful electron donors that harm biomolecules when they react with free radicals. The antioxidant radical that is produced is unreactive and stable. By neutralizing free radicals at comparatively low concentrations, antioxidants, which are highly numerous and varied in nature, can potentially stop oxidants’ chain reactions and thwart the oxidation process. [15] Maintaining membranes, enzymes, biosynthetic capability, and free radical scavenging mechanisms all depend on dietary antioxidants and a few auxiliary chemicals like zinc and certain vitamins. The vegetable oils include antioxidants. For instance, evening prime rose oil, soybean oil, canola oil, corn oil, oat oil, wheat germ oil, and palm oil. [16]

Alzheimer’s disease and nutraceuticals:
The most prevalent type of dementia is Alzheimer’s disease (AD). The illness has no known cure and ultimately results in death. AD is diagnosed most frequently. Alzheimer’s disease, which is less common, can develop significantly earlier in persons over 65. [27] In 2006, there were 26.6 million victims worldwide, and by 2050, 1 in 85 individuals are expected to be impacted. [28] At a ratio of nearly 2:1, women are more impacted than men. Numerous lines of evidence indicate that oxidative stress may be linked to AD and other neurodegenerative diseases. By preventing oxidative stress, nutraceutical antioxidants like lutein, lycopene, turmeric, curcumin, and β-carotene may help treat some illnesses. The idea that these substances can delay the onset of dementias like AD [29] is the reason behind the rising trends in the use of nutraceuticals. Numerous recent studies have demonstrated the beneficial effects of various nutraceutical herbs, including Zizyphus jujube and Lavandula officinalis, on AD, learning, and memory. [30,31,32,33]
Parkinson’s disease and Nutraceuticals:
Unknown factors lead to the degeneration of dopamine-generating cells in the substantia nigra, which produces Parkinson’s disease, a degenerative condition of the central nervous system with movement symptoms. Movement-related symptoms, such as stiffness, sluggishness, tremor, and trouble walking and gait, are the most noticeable. Problems with thinking and conduct are signs of the disease in its severe stages. The most prevalent mental health symptom is depression, which manifests as emotional, sleep, and sensory issues. The majority of Parkinson’s disease instances occur beyond the age of 50, making it more prevalent in older adults. [34] While there is currently insufficient scientific evidence to support the use of nutritional supplements for Parkinson’s disease, some of these supplements have demonstrated encouraging outcomes in early research. Parkinson’s disease appears to be prevented by vitamin E, glutathione, and creatine. [35]

Cancer:
The development of cancer is a long-term, dynamic process. This process progresses step-by-step and incorporates numerous intricate aspects. These elements eventually cause metastasis, which is the unchecked growth and spread of malignant cells throughout the body. Dietary factors can alter carcinogenesis, according to epidemiological studies. Numerous natural products or bioactive dietary components have been shown in laboratory studies to have the potential to prevent cancer. It has been discovered that several food ingredients with as-yet-unidentified nutritional benefits also contain antimutagenic and anti-carcinogenic qualities. Additionally, nutraceuticals help patients overcome the negative effects of cancer treatment and enhance their overall health. According to some study, lifestyle modifications, such as proper eating, can prevent one-third of all cancer-related deaths. A lot of people utilize botanicals to treat cancer. Alkaloids from the Pacific yew Taxus brevifolia (Taxol) and the Vinca species (vincristine and vinblastine) are useful in the treatment of cancer. The same plants are often utilized for the same symptoms in across cultures, which suggests that they are likely highly beneficial medicinally for those kinds of foods. Despite significant medical advancements, cancer remains a global health concern. Numerous plant extracts can be used to both prevent and treat cancer. The therapy of cancer patients may benefit from nutritional modification. There is evidence that cancer patients benefit from diets that contain moderate levels of high-quality protein, fiber, and fat and very little simple carbohydrate. Additionally, nutraceuticals may help lessen the toxicity of radiation and chemotherapy. By lowering cancer, it could result in improved living conditions. The ways in which the phytochemicals work at various cellular levels vary. Adaptable antioxidant source that Influences the signaling pathway associated with transcription factors regulated by redox. Additionally, they directly alter the immunological cascade, the endocrine system, and Inflammatory enzymes. Some of them have demonstrated a direct impact on the cleavage and Repair processes of DNA. [39,40,41,42]
Osteoarthritis:
An estimated 21 million Americans suffer with osteoarthritis (OA), a crippling joint condition that Is the most prevalent type of arthritis in the country. About 86 billion dollars were spent on direct and indirect medical expenses related to arthritis in 2004. People who suffer from OA and other Joint disorders may become less active due to joint discomfort, which can lead to weight gain and Energy imbalance. Gaining weight can make pre-existing issues worse by putting more strain on Joints. [43] Chondroitin Sulfate(CS) and glucosamine(GLN) are frequently used to reduce OA Symptoms. These nutraceuticals possess both medicinal and nutritional qualities. They seem to Control NO and PGE2 synthesis and gene expression, offering a plausible explanation for their Anti-inflammatory properties. [44]
Obesity:
An excessive quantity of body fat is known as obesity, and it is a known risk factor for a number of illnesses, including angina pectoris, congestive heart failure, high blood pressure, hyperlipidemia, respiratory conditions, renal vein thrombosis, osteoarthritis, cancer, and decreased fertility. The increased availability of foods high in fat and energy density is one of the main reasons for the sharp increase in obesity prevalence. For body weight loss, a safe and efficient nutraceutical that can raise energy expenditure and/or lower calorie intake is preferred. Herbal stimulants that have been shown to help with weight loss include ephedrine, caffeine, ma huang-guarana, chitosan, and green tea. Green tea extract and 5-hydroxytryptophan may help people lose weight; the latter improves energy expenditure while the former reduces hunger. [45,46]
